At this stage,the public should pay attention to the lack of food nutrition,nutrition education is essential.Moreover,the government has paid more and more attention to this aspect of food nutrition science popularization in recent years,and with the rapid development and wide application of Internet technology,the Popular Science Information of food nutrition has many forms of propaganda on the network media,but the quality is uneven.Along with the lack of people for these information from the public,such online public opinion has gradually spread,and has an impact on society,to the point where regulation has to be stepped up.According to the current need to strengthen the supervision of the information of food nutrition science popularization,this paper designs and realizes the information monitoring system of food nutrition science popularization based on the topic reptile,and carries out the new information monitoring of food nutrition science popularization,to achieve correct guidance,scientific disposal,to ensure the public’s health and nutrition safety.On the basis of the research on the main technologies of the network public opinion analysis system,and in view of the actual demand for such information,this article has carried out the following aspects of work:1.According to the characteristics of food nutrition science information dissemination and lack of supervision to demand analysis,according to the results of the analysis,the architecture of food nutrition Popular Science Information Monitoring System was designed.According to the hierarchy to build,mainly divided into three layers,respectively for food nutrition science information data acquisition layer,core service layer(including food nutrition Data pre-processing and Related Algorithm Implementation),function display layer(display the analysis result of popular science information of food nutrition,including public opinion dynamic,public opinion attribute and so on).According to the design of the system architecture,the data collection,core service and function display modules of the popular science information of food nutrition have been designed,and the corresponding database of the popular science information of food nutrition has been designed,including crawling information table,data source information table and other database tables.2.For the realization of the main functions of the food nutrition science popularization information monitoring system,it is necessary to research and implement the related techniques and Algorithms,including data collection,text clustering,text classification,sentiment analysis and so on.First of all,we need to get the data of food nutrition Popular Science Information Field,and use the topic crawler to get it.The data source of the topic crawler is the website with high public sentiment.The system is mainly: Weibo,Wechat public accounts,Baidu post it,the selection of key words in the popular science of food and nutrition is mainly determined by the nutrition dictionary section,the dietary supplement function,and the words close to the field(fruit,agriculture,etc.).After obtaining the data,it is necessary to pre-process the popular science information of food nutrition,including word segmentation,stop word processing,and so on,the F1 value is a measure of the Algorithm’s strengths and weaknesses.In order to realize the function of topic tracking and detection,we need to use text clustering and text classification algorithm.The algorithms used in text clustering are LDA subject model,K-means,DBSCN.Through the comparison of indexes,DBSCN is more accurate,KNN,Bayes,through the comparison of indicators,naive Bayes more accurate.Therefore,the DBSCN and naive Bayes are applied to the system.In order to realize the function of public opinion attribute of popular science information of food nutrition,text emotion analysis is needed.The algorithms used are LSTM,CNN,RNN.3.Based on the analysis of the information requirement of the popular science of food nutrition,the functional modules of the system are designed and the selection experiment of the algorithm suitable for the system is completed,the Food Nutrition Science Popularization Information Monitoring System based on topic crawler has been completed and realized,including visual display,information management,system management,report form statistics and so on.This system chooses b/s system structure,the foreground uses Layui framework to build,the background uses Spring boot framework,uses Java,Python as development language,Java to implement the system development,and the topic crawler and algorithm design in the system is Python.MySQL is the system database,which is deployed on the same physical server as the site ontology.After the system is developed,the system is tested.The test results show that the system meets the required functional and performance requirements,and can be used to monitor and analyze the basic food nutrition information.The system has been applied in the Institute of food and nutrition development of the Ministry of Agriculture and rural areas.The practice shows that the system can meet the needs of users for monitoring and analyzing the popular science information of food nutrition,be Able to keep abreast of food nutrition related science and technology trends. |